<p>PROBLEM TO BE SOLVED: To provide an earthquake strengthening method for an existing steel bearing, which capable of eliminating the need for jack-up of a super structure, reducing the number of parts to be replaced, simplifying the construction, and suppressing manufacturing cost to be low.SOLUTION: An earthquake strengthening method for an existing steel bearing includes the steps of: hacking a weld part of a sole plate 8; widening both sides of a bottom flange 4a in a fitting part of an upper shoe 1; fitting stoppers 32, 33 provided so as to leave a predetermined interval apart from the upper shoe along a bridge axial direction and in the direction perpendicular to the bridge axis in an underside of the bottom flange 4a including widened parts 30; and fitting knock-off bolts 37 each having a breaking planned part at its bolt shank intermediate part as new set bolts instead of set bolts so that the breaking planned part is positioned at a boundary surface between the bottom flange and the sole plate 8.</p> |
